Can 2010 Lexus Rx-450h rotors be resurfaced or do they need to be replaced?

Rotors can be resurfaced only if their remaining thickness is above the minimum spec stamped on the rotor; otherwise, they must be replaced.

On a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h, our technicians first mic the rotors and compare the readings to the minimum thickness cast or stamped into each rotor hat. Many modern rotors reach or approach this limit by the first wear cycle, making resurfacing impractical. We’ll document thickness, runout, and surface condition and provide an OEM-based recommendation for your driving in Hingham and surrounding areas.

  • Minimum thickness is printed on each rotor; we measure and record it.
  • If below spec (or would be after machining), replacement is required.

Do I need to replace rotors when I replace pads on a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h?

No—rotor replacement isn’t automatic; it depends on rotor thickness and surface condition relative to the minimum specification.

For a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h, we evaluate rotor thickness, runout, and surface finish during any pad replacement. If rotors are above minimum thickness and surfaces are even, a pad slap with proper bedding may be appropriate. If there’s scoring, heat checking, or thickness variation, we’ll recommend resurfacing (if safely possible) or replacement using Lexus OEM rotors.

  • We mic rotors and check runout before pad decisions.
  • Front and rear rotors may differ; we measure per axle.

What are the signs of bad rotors on a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h?

Common signs include brake pulsation, steering-wheel shake under braking, visible grooves or blue heat marks, and rotors worn below the minimum thickness spec.

On a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h, you may notice vibration through the pedal or wheel, longer stopping distances, or a harsh scraping sound. Visual cues include scoring, rust ridges, or heat spotting from high-temperature events. Our Hingham service team confirms issues by measuring thickness and runout and inspecting pads for uneven transfer layers.

  • Pulsation at highway stops often indicates rotor thickness variation.
  • Blue spots and cracks suggest overheating or pad imprinting.

What’s the difference between OEM and aftermarket rotors for a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h?

OEM Lexus rotors match factory metallurgy, vane design, and NVH tuning for the RX platform; aftermarket quality varies by tier and may alter braking feel or noise.

For a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h, Lexus-spec rotors are engineered for proper heat dissipation and smoothness with OEM pads. Aftermarket options range from economy to performance grades, but not all maintain Lexus noise, vibration, and harshness targets. We recommend OEM or proven equivalents when NVH and longevity are priorities.

  • OEM geometry supports even pad contact and cooling.
  • Aftermarket tolerances differ; results can vary.

Is rotor replacement covered under warranty on a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h?

Brake rotors are typically classified as wear items and are not covered by new-vehicle warranties; manufacturing defects may be covered.

For a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h, warranty coverage generally excludes wear-and-tear on rotors, while defects are handled per Lexus policy. Warranty work usually requires a certified facility, which protects you by ensuring OEM procedures, documentation, and parts traceability. We can inspect, document measurements, and advise on eligibility.

  • Wear items are normally excluded; defects may qualify.
  • Certified repair is often required for warranty claims.

Why are my 2010 Lexus Rx-450h rotors warping?

Most “warping” is uneven pad material transfer from heat, not literal rotor warpage, often triggered by hot stops or improper lug-nut torque.

On a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h, hard braking to a stop and holding the pedal can imprint pad material, creating thickness variation that causes pulsation. Corrosion at the hub-rotor interface and uneven wheel torque can add lateral runout. We clean the hub face, torque wheels precisely, and bed pads/rotors correctly to minimize recurrence.

  • Heat soak and pad imprinting cause thickness variation.
  • Rust scale under the rotor can induce runout.
  • We use torque sticks and proper bedding procedures.
How long do rotors last on a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h in Hingham?

There’s no fixed mileage interval; rotors should be measured at every brake service and replaced when at or near the minimum thickness.

Actual lifespan on a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h depends on driving (city vs. highway), load, and conditions in Massachusetts. Stop-and-go traffic and winter road treatments can accelerate wear or corrosion. During each visit, we mic rotors, check runout, and advise whether resurfacing is safe or replacement is required.

  • No set interval—condition-based replacement is best.
  • Local stop-and-go and corrosion can shorten life.

What’s Included in a 2010 Lexus Rx-450h Rotor Replacement

Our process for the 2010 Lexus Rx-450h follows Lexus procedures to restore smooth, confident braking. We begin by measuring rotor thickness at multiple points and checking lateral runout. After documenting results, we remove the caliper and rotor, then clean the hub face to bare metal to prevent runout from rust scale. We install Lexus OEM rotors, refresh any required hardware, and verify pad condition and even contact. We also check brake fluid level and condition. To finish, we bed-in pads and rotors using a controlled procedure and complete a road test to verify pulsation-free stops. Wear items are inspected and documented for transparency.
